The Department of Master of Computer Applications (MCA) at The Kavery Engineering College was established in the year 2007 with the objective of producing skilled computing professionals. The department offers MCA programmes with an industry-oriented curriculum, modern laboratories, and experienced faculty members to prepare students for successful careers in the IT industry.

The department emphasizes academic excellence, innovation, research, and practical learning through advanced laboratories, industry collaborations, value-added courses, internships, and project-based learning. Students gain exposure to emerging technologies including Artificial Intelligence, Machine Learning, Data Science, Cloud Computing, and Cyber Security.

Through continuous interaction with industries, professional bodies, and research organizations, the department nurtures technical expertise, problem-solving abilities, leadership qualities, and employability skills to meet global technological demands and prepare graduates for higher education, research, and entrepreneurship.

Computer Laboratories

The Department of Master of Computer Applications provides modern computing laboratories equipped with advanced computer systems, high-speed internet connectivity, and industry-standard software platforms. The laboratories support practical learning, programming, database development, web technologies, machine learning, Internet of Things (IoT), and software project development to prepare students for the evolving IT industry.

Training & Placement

The Department of Training and Placement provides excellent career opportunities for MCA students through campus recruitment, industry interactions, and skill development programmes. Students receive training in aptitude, technical skills, programming, communication, and interview techniques to improve their employability.

Regular workshops, mock interviews, coding sessions, and placement drives are conducted with leading IT companies. The department also encourages internships and industry projects, helping students gain practical experience and build successful careers in the software and IT industry.

Academic Year Wise Placement Details

Academic Year Companies Visited Offers Made Students Selected Average Salary (LPA) Maximum Salary (LPA)
2025-2026 06 46 22 3 LPA 4 LPA
2024-2025 07 28 21 3 LPA 4 LPA
2023-2024 08 15 05 3 LPA 4 LPA
